airmid healthgroup science team
At airmid healthgroup ltd our mission is to prevent ill health caused by exposure to indoor air pollutants. To achieve this goal we have assembled a unique multidisciplinary team of Clinicians, Industrial Hygienists, Occupational Health Advisers, and Specialist Laboratory Scientists in Mycology, Virology, Bacteriology, Allergy and Immunology.

Angela Southey PhD Angela has responsibility for the running of our Virology Laboratory and Environmental Testing Chambers. Angela qualified with a BSc. in Microbiology from UCC, before going on to complete a PhD in Lung Fibrosis in UCD. She then spent two years working in Japan on Ulcerative Colitis with Tanabe Seiyaku Ltd. Returning to Ireland she took up a senior research position in the Veterinary College, UCD followed by extensive industry experience in the diagnostic area with Wyeth Biopharma and Abbott Diagnostics. |

John Fallon PhD John graduated from the National University of Ireland Maynooth with a BSc in Biological Sciences. Following completion of his undergraduate studies John remained at NUIM to complete a PhD in the medical mycology unit examining the disease causing potential of environmental isolates of Aspergillus fumigatus in vertebrate and invertebrate immune systems. John has significant experience in the field of mould culture and phenotypic analysis as well as having published data concerning the detrimental effects of mycotoxins produced by A. fumigatus on the function of immune cells. |
